We welcome to the market this beautiful, detached home, originally built circa 1750 as a counting-house, now offering spacious accommodation in a superb rural setting with period features such as exposed beams and original fireplaces. Sitting within a plot of approximately half an acre, this home near Otterburn offers generous outside space with uninterrupted panoramic views of the Northumberland countryside. This is a peaceful retreat in natural surroundings, but with good road links providing access to surrounding towns for amenities.
The internal accommodation comprises entrance vestibule; through to a sitting room, a great room for entertaining with exposed beams; a spacious living room with a traditional exposed brick feature fireplace and the first of two staircases to the first floor; kitchen/diner boasting a range of fitted base, drawer and wall units in a chic wood finish; sunroom perfect to relax in with surrounding windows flooding in natural light and offering woodland views; a spacious dining room with second staircase to the first floor; utility room; and a convenient downstairs W.C.
The first floor can be accessed by either of the two staircases. These lead to two separate landings, each giving access to two bedrooms and a family bathroom. All four bedrooms are double with space for bedroom furniture and offer tasteful décor and fitted wardrobes for extra storage. Opportunities to create a home office or study are there if desired.

Externally, the property offers a double garage, a workshop, and generous private gardens mainly laid to lawn with mature woodland and shrubbery surrounding creating a private feel. Breath-taking natural views are offered from the gardens also.
This property offers an attractive prospect to families, those retiring to the countryside or even those wishing to offer small scale B&B due to the separate landings and access on the first floor.
